PYR2-485 is an ISO 9060:2018 Class C (Second Class) Thermopile Pyranometer

Ideal for scientific and meteorological use. It comes with RS485 Modbus output line suitable for distances up to 500m.

It has a simpler construction than the Class B, but uses the same high quality materials.

PYR2-485 – designed for accuracy and reliability

The PYR2-485 is equipped with the electronics board with a microcontroller to manage sampling, average of sampling, temperature reading and RS485 transmissions. This helps to guarantee noise immunity and constant behavior over intervals of time and temperature variations. The output signal is in Modbus RTU over RS485.

The carefully selected components have a constant behavior over time and for a wide temperature range. The distances covered by the signals exceed 500 meters.

Since 2022 the “virtual bubble level” has been implemented thanks to a very precise inclinometer (14 bits to express inclinations X and Y) that, through the Allconfig program, enables you to put it “in bubble”, that is, in a horizontal position. Registers of the inclinometer are published; so that it is possible to control its horizontality (rather than the inclination) remotely.

This instrument is suitable for measuring solar power and monitoring the efficiency of photovoltaic systems when a precision of 5% – 10% is sufficient.

Key features

  • Thermopile sensor (300 ÷ 2900 nm)
  • Single dome in hemispherical optical type glass with high transparency
  • Anodized aluminum body ideal for outdoor use
  • Output on RS485 Modbus line, f.s. 1600W/ m2 (± 2W) for distances up to 500m
  • 50m current loop cable
  • High weather resistance
  • ISO 9060 compliant
  • Accurate calibrations with a Secondary Standard (Class A Thermopile Pyranometer) rechecked every 12 months.
  • 2 year warranty

Datasheet

NAME PYR2-485
PRODUCT PYR2-485 – Class C Thermopile Pyranometer
REFERENCE STANDARDS ISO 9060:1990, ISO 9060:2018
OUTPUT Modbus RTU on RS485
Calibration ISO9847 compliant With a Secondary Standard (Class A) Pyranometer, certified calibration
Spectral sensitivity 300 ÷ 2900 nm
Input range 0 ÷ 1600 W/m2
Response time < 25 seconds
Resolution Smallest detectable change Irradiance: ± 1 W/m2

Inclination: 0.1°

Working temperature -40 ÷ +80°C
Field of view 180°
Stability (over 1 year) < ± 1%
Output Modbus Adrs.257 Irradiance; Adrs. 34817 Pyr Temp

Adrs. 259 Inclin. x axis, Adrs.260 Inclin. y axis

Supply 9÷30 Vdc protected against short circuit
Encapsulation Quartz [k5] dome 0.3μm ÷ 3μm
Case Anodized Aluminum
Connector standard female M8 4 pin
Dimensions Φ 162 x h 104 mm

  • Sm configuration for Android smartphone and tablet

    SMCONFIG allows you to configure PYR2-485 in the field from your Android smartphone. It is no longer necessary to bring thermopile pyranometer back to the laboratory for configuration.

    The software allows you to:

    • configure Thermopile Pyranometer.
    • make a diagnosis of the basic functions.
    • log irradiance, temperature and wind (Sunmeter Wind only) readings.

    The software is available for free on this page in the downloads area. In addition to the software it is necessary to have a USB / RS485 converter, an adapter cable between microUSB/USB and a male connector M8 4 pin.
    In the Download area you can find a wiring diagram of our cable that connects Smartphone/Tablet or PC with pyranometer, it takes and transforms the voltage present on the USB (Price on request). Alternatively, it is possible to use other cables with external power supply (9V battery).
